Ingredients

  1. 4 cups thinly sliced Napa (Chinese) cabbage
  2. 1 large carrot, peeled and coarsely grated
  3. 1 Tbsp. chopped fresh dill
  4. 2 Tbsp. olive oil
  5. ¼ cup lemon juice
  6. Salt and pepper to taste
  7. 2 Clementine or Mandarin oranges, peeled and segmented
  8. ¼ cup shelled unsalted sunflower seeds
  9. 1 tsp. flaxseeds

Directions

  1. In a medium bowl, toss together cabbage, carrot, and dill.
  2. In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, salt and pepper. Pour over cabbage mixture and toss well to coat.
  3. Stir in citrus segments and sunflower seeds, and set aside at room temperature for 15 minutes before serving.

Serving size: 1¼ cups

Exchanges per Serving: ½ Carb, ½ Protein, 1½ Fat
